Output 53cbe22c517055e58dafd7086ea3a1734bf533e9d4e923abf12901073de897e5:3

value
23925400
script pubkey
OP_0 OP_PUSHBYTES_20 d25754a0d216edb6d0d2b57aeb74bd9f00635d49
address
bc1q6ft4fgxjzmkmd5xjk4awka9anuqxxh2fu6rf37
transaction
53cbe22c517055e58dafd7086ea3a1734bf533e9d4e923abf12901073de897e5
confirmations
144648
spent
true